what type of map might represent the population distribution in your state with lighter and darker shading for population densit

y

Answer:

   Choropleth map.

Explanation:

  It is the most common of the thematic maps. It portrays quantitive data in areas shaded or patterned in proportion to the measurement of the statistical variable being displayed on the map. Sequential colors represent increasing or decreasing data values.

  Choropleth map is normally used to show population density or per-capita income.
